Powder coating machines are advanced systems designed to apply durable, high-quality finishes to various surfaces. Key components include a powder spray gun, electrostatic generator, curing oven, conveyor system, and powder recovery unit. These machines work by electrostatically charging powder particles, which adhere to the surface before being cured into a smooth, durable coating.
2. Applications of Powder Coating Machines
Powder coating machines are widely used in industries such as automotive (for wheels, frames), aerospace (for engine parts), furniture (for metal frames), and appliances (for panels). They are also popular in architectural, agricultural, and electronics manufacturing due to their versatility and durability.

4. Proper Usage of Powder Coating Machines
To achieve optimal results, clean parts thoroughly before coating, adjust electrostatic settings for even powder distribution, and maintain consistent curing temperatures. Regular maintenance of spray guns and recovery systems ensures long-term efficiency and performance.
5. How to Choose the Right Powder Coating Machine
When selecting a Powder coating machine, consider production volume, part size, and material compatibility. High-volume operations benefit from conveyorized systems, while smaller businesses may prefer compact, manual models. Energy efficiency and supplier support are also critical factors.
6. Safety Precautions for Powder Coating Machines
Ensure proper ventilation to avoid inhaling powder particles. Ground all equipment to prevent electrostatic discharge. Operators must wear PPE, including masks, gloves, and protective eyewear. Regularly inspect electrical components and ovens to minimize fire hazards.

8. Q&A on Powder Coating Machines
Q: How does a powder coating machine work?
A: It electrostatically charges powder particles, which adhere to the surface before being cured into a durable finish.
Q: Which industries use powder coating machines most?
A: Automotive, aerospace, and furniture industries are top users due to their need for durable finishes.
Q: Can these machines handle complex part geometries?
A: Yes, adjustable spray guns and rotating fixtures ensure full coverage on intricate shapes.
Q: Are powder coatings eco-friendly?
A: Yes, powder coatings are free of VOCs, making them environmentally safe.
Q: What maintenance is required for these machines?
A: Regular cleaning of spray guns and powder recovery systems is essential for optimal performance.
